Given the mix of high speed boats, guns and daring deeds, it’s perhaps surprising that Coastal Forces has not been the subject of more than one Hollywood feature film. Of course, Hollywood has largely concentrated on it’s own and so the two most famous films about the ‘little ships’ feature PT boats instead of MTBs; They were Expendable (1945) and PT 109 (1963). The one film that does feature the Royal Navy’s little ships, Hell Boats (1970), is not what could really be described as a classic of the period.
Fortunately there are a few British films that have featured Coastal Forces, although they tend to be quite old. The earliest date from the war years and the most recent dates to 1955. There is a mix of short documentaries, feature films and even adverts that provide us with a tantalising glimpse of these boats at the height of their fame.
